Anybody know how to setup the MS3X board to run VT-VY coilpacks?

 

Only information I can find is from people using previous versions of megasquirts and it doesn't seem to be applicable as they add another board to there version of MS to gain extra spark control outputs but the board they use has a "high voltage" output as compared to the MS3X which only puts out a "logic level" output and is not a high enough current to drive the coil directly. I'm  guessing I use the GM ignition module to be used to drive the coils and use  MS3To drive the ignition module. Not sure how though!

Alright I wanted to make sure before I posted any information.

 

With most of the GM DIS systems, the 3800 included the connections are very much like a dizzy. There are 4 basic wires needed between the ECM and the ICM. "Ref LO" usually black/red, "ESC" usually white, "REF HI" usually purple/white and bypass, usually tan/black.

 

The REF LO is basically a ground between the ECM and the ICM, to make sure they have the same ground potential.

 

The ESC is what actually controls the timing.

 

The REF HI, is the trigger to the ECM, in GM terms the signal is called a "DRP" or Distributor Reference Pulse. This will send one pulse for each ignition event.

 

The bypass will have 5V applied to it above 400 RPM is stock GM configurations, some Megasquirters like to apply 5V all the time and use the ECM to control timing during crank. This is also the wire that you disconnect to set base timing.

 

The other connections to the 3800 module include the crank sensor, and usually a cam sensor as well, though I don't recall if the ICM actually uses the cam sensor or if it's just a pass through on those modules.

 

I read people suggesting to tear apart the module and use some other MOSFETS to trigger the coils which makes the ICM itself pointless, other than for mounting, which could be done with a flat plate, if you go that route. I use the GM DIS myself, though I'm also using a GM ECM, the ECM and code I am using did not originally support DIS, and had to change some parameters to get it to work.

 

The GM ICMs have a built in LHM spark mode, that will have spark even with no ECM in the car, as long as it gets ignition, grounds and crank trigger. It's a great thing for diagnostics. ;)

 

If you look in the Megamanual under the GM Ignition section you will see reference to the dizzy ICM, and the 2.0L and 60 degree V6 style ignitions. These ignitions require a 60* offset to work correctly, after start. The 3800 modules require a 33* offset to have correct timing, otherwise the set-up is very much the same as for a GM dizzy.

The easiest way is to use the ICM as it is. ;)

 

The extra parts to add are a resistor and a couple jumper wires IIRC. A lot easier to add than modifying an ICM. ;)

 

If you truly want to utilize the expander board, forget any DIS ICM and drive some COP coils, with built in ignitors. ;)
